Next up, we are planning a small Kickstarter campaign for around August based on the Terran Heavy Mech.

(http://images.dakkadakka.com/gallery/2014/3/12/592908_sm-Terran%20Heavy%20Mech%20Concept.jpg) (http://www.dakkadakka.com/gallery/592908-Terran%20Heavy%20Mech%20Concept.html)

He’ll be around 4-5 inches tall and most likely 100% resin and come with a variety of weapons to make your own payloads or 2 special pilots. Terran Titans will get Behemoth, he’ll be armed with a Railgun, Crushefist, 2 Chaingun turrets and 1 Missile Pod. Team Bushido will get Kaiju, he’ll have 1 Plasmagun, 1 Wrecking Ball, 2 Blaster Turrets and 1 Chaingun turret. So a total of 4 arm weapons and 6 turrets. We’re going to start sculpting it in May, but I wanted to get a few resin masters to paint up before the campaign so that’s why it won’t be happening till August.

If we get the heavy mech funded we’ll be introducing a new unit type for stretch goals, tentatively called Rookies. They will be men in extra-heavy battlesuits, the models will be comparible in size to a GW Terminator, but with big 2-handed heavy weapons that are basically a modified mech arm turned into a rifle. We’ll have different versions for each ranged weapon in the game. Here’s some concept art:

(http://images.dakkadakka.com/gallery/2015/3/26/699019_sm-Rookie%20Concept.png) (http://www.dakkadakka.com/gallery/699019-Rookie%20Concept.html)

If the campaign happens to do really well we’ll also add in the mechs for other races too, but the only things we’ll sculpt ahead of time will be the Heavy and Rookies, other races would end up shipping as a “Wave 2” kind of thing. Our goal is to expand the range in a few short, small & focused campaigns rather than promising everything we can and falling short. I want to able to ship earlier than planned again :) So the simpler the campaign will be, the better.

Anyway, the drones are going to change a little. First they are getting shrunk down to fit on a 40mm base and will be made in resin so they’re cheaper. The missile pod will only come with the crawler body, and that will be the Missile Drone, just like in the pic above. I had Dave sculpt an all new smaller blaster turret for the rover body, and that will become the Blaster Drone. Here’s a little video showing how that will look :)

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=V6kjW-xYD2I (https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=V6kjW-xYD2I)

As an added bonus, the new blaster turret fits perfectly on top of a light mech, so I’ll be doing a new Free Agent pilot to utilize that, probably with the top blaster and 2 crusherfists. The drones will also go in the new official starter sets, 2 drones and 1 light mech for each team.. but I won’t know what the price for that will be till I get the new models done. Hoping for around $35 or so.
